Project Objectives• Creating a binder which aids in the overall learning experience, while on a 6th grade field trip to Kansas City.•Assisting GT teachers as volunteer supervisors on the field trip.

Page 4: East/Empacts Project Introduction to Education Fall 2007

Creating a BinderThe binder was composed of crossword puzzles, word searches, word jumbles, trivia, games, connect the dots, and a journal and sketch section. It also had maps of the destination, and the route to get there.
